What is the meaning of social climb?

: one who attempts to gain a higher social position or acceptance in fashionable society.

How can you tell if someone is a social climber?

Social climbers use friendships to enhance their own status.

Is social climbing a bad thing?

Based on Psychology Today, social climbing behaviors may stem from a low self-esteem and an extreme tendency toward self-comparison. Despite their talkative-social butterfly behaviors, they are actually really insecure about themselves.

What do social climbers do?

According to the Urban Dictionary, a social climber is those who become friends with someone else if that person has something that they want or need. Social climbers value human relationship based on popularity and status, as those two things are their primary needs.

What do you call a social climber?

parvenu. A person who has suddenly risen to a higher social and economic class and has not yet gained social acceptance by others in that class.

What is the definition of social climbing?

social climbing. also social-climbing. uncountable noun. You describe someone’s behaviour as social climbing when they try to get accepted into a higher social class by becoming friendly with people who belong to that class.
